public void SaveExecute(object parametar) { try { if (ButtonAddContent == "Cancel") { Dobavljanje modify = new Dobavljanje(); modify.Artikal_SIF_ART = SifraArtikla; modify.Kolicina = kolicina; modify.Cena_Dobavljaca = Cena; modify.Marza_Procenat = Marza; modify.Kalkulacija_SIF_KALK = BrKalk; _ctx.Dobavljanjes.Add(modify); } else { if (SelectedItem == null) { return; } SelectedItem.Artikal_SIF_ART = SifraArtikla; } _ctx.SaveChanges(); Refresh(); SelectedItem = Collection.View.CurrentItem as Dobavljanje; } catch (Exception e) { throw e; } }
private void Button2_Click(object sender, EventArgs e) { if (dgvDobavljanja.SelectedRows.Count > 0) { Dobavljanje dobavljanjeZaBrisanje = (Dobavljanje)dgvDobavljanja.SelectedRows[0].DataBoundItem; listaDobavljanja.Remove(dobavljanjeZaBrisanje); } }
public int SacuvajDobavljanje(Dobavljanje d) { SqlCommand command = new SqlCommand("Insert into Dobavljanje values(@Dobavljac, @Proizvod, @Datum, @Opis)"); command.Parameters.AddWithValue("@Dobavljac", d.Dobavljac); command.Parameters.AddWithValue("@Proizvod", d.Proizvod); command.Parameters.AddWithValue("@Datum", d.Datum); command.Parameters.AddWithValue("@Opis", d.Opis); return(command.ExecuteNonQuery()); }
private void Button1_Click(object sender, EventArgs e) { Dobavljanje dobavljanje = new Dobavljanje { Dobavljac = (Dobavljac)cmbDobavljac.SelectedItem, Proizvod = (Proizvod)cmbProizvod.SelectedItem, Datum = DateTime.ParseExact(txtDatum.Text, "dd.MM.yyyy.", null), Opis = txtOpis.Text }; Dobavljanje = dobavljanje; Close(); }